Output 520f393b6f7fb00ce3c9e58c1fe94534acec4b71361e2b026ad79180a89d600b:348

value
17695015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20ec32fd4183f738472498d8989b6d5e90702b06 OP_EQUAL
address
MAuEoyX6vpDbteh1K2t3tbUL8xgAYs7PJa
transaction
520f393b6f7fb00ce3c9e58c1fe94534acec4b71361e2b026ad79180a89d600b
spent
true